Struct aws_sdk_ec2::input::DescribeFleetsInput [−][src]
#[non_exhaustive]pub struct DescribeFleetsInput {
pub dry_run: Option<bool>,
pub max_results: Option<i32>,
pub next_token: Option<String>,
pub fleet_ids: Option<Vec<String>>,
pub filters: Option<Vec<Filter>>,
}
Fields (Non-exhaustive)
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Struct { .. }
sy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..
; and struct update syntax will not work.dry_run: Option<bool>
Checks whether you have the required permissions for the action, without actually making the request,
and provides an error response. If you have the required permissions, the error response is DryRunOperation
.
Otherwise, it is UnauthorizedOperation
.
max_results: Option<i32>
The maximum number of results to return in a single call. Specify a value between 1 and
1000. The default value is 1000. To retrieve the remaining results, make another call with
the returned NextToken
value.
next_token: Option<String>
The token for the next set of results.
fleet_ids: Option<Vec<String>>
The ID of the EC2 Fleets.
filters: Option<Vec<Filter>>
The filters.
-
activity-status
- The progress of the EC2 Fleet (error
|pending-fulfillment
|pending-termination
|fulfilled
). -
excess-capacity-termination-policy
- Indicates whether to terminate running instances if the target capacity is decreased below the current EC2 Fleet size (true
|false
). -
fleet-state
- The state of the EC2 Fleet (submitted
|active
|deleted
|failed
|deleted-running
|deleted-terminating
|modifying
). -
replace-unhealthy-instances
- Indicates whether EC2 Fleet should replace unhealthy instances (true
|false
). -
type
- The type of request (instant
|request
|maintain
).
